Lantek CAD/CAM Migration, Postprocessor & Setup Service — independent retrofit and upgrade work carried out on the Lantek software and parameter set of a CNC cutting machine. No scope is written before a compatibility assessment of your exact machine, control, wiring and mechanical condition. Final scope, parts, timing and price are confirmed after the assessment; repair, replacement or upgrade is recommended only once the unit has been evaluated.
Possible upgrade scope
- Software migration to replacement workstations
- Machine database, material and technology-table transfer
- Postprocessor review and compatible machine-output setup
- Nesting workflow, file-path and network configuration
- Backup planning, testing and operator guidance
Who this fits
- Shops whose nesting or control software is no longer supported on current hardware
- Owners who need parameters, recipes and post-processors carried across a migration
- Plants standardizing CAM output and machine profiles across several machines
- Buyers of used equipment with an unclear software license position
What the compatibility assessment covers
| Item | What is checked | Why it decides the scope |
|---|---|---|
| Installed version and license | Software build, dongle or license state and ownership | License transfer is the first thing that either works or blocks the whole job |
| Parameter and recipe backup | What backups exist, and where | Without a backup the cutting recipes are rebuilt from scratch |
| Post-processor and machine profile | Machine profile, post and kerf tables | The post is what makes the software output usable on your machine |
| Hardware compatibility | Control PC, card, OS and CNC platform | Older control cards frequently block a straight software upgrade |
| Operator workflow | Nesting, import formats, ERP hand-off and reporting | The migration is judged on the operator workflow, not the install |

Compatibility data required
Send this set and the first-round questions are already answered:
- Machine make, model, year and CNC platform
- Current software name, version and license or dongle details
- Any parameter, recipe or post-processor backups you hold
- Screenshots of the current control and nesting screens
- Typical part files and the formats your CAD sends
- What is failing today, in one paragraph
Limits stated before the work starts
- License transfer is decided by the software vendor, not by UmproTech
- Cutting recipes may need re-validation on your material after migration
- Some legacy control hardware cannot run current software at any price
